Ecclesiastes:2:12-16
gltv@Ecclesiastes:2:12 @ And I turned to behold wisdom, and madness, and folly. For what can a man do who comes after the king, when they have already done it?
gltv@Ecclesiastes:2:13 @ Then I saw that there is advantage to wisdom above folly, even as light has advantage over darkness.
gltv@Ecclesiastes:2:14 @ The wise man's eyes are in his head; but the fool walks in darkness; and I also know that one event happens with all of them.
gltv@Ecclesiastes:2:15 @ And I said in my heart, As the event of the stupid one, even so it will happen to me; and why then was I more wise? Then I said in my heart that this also is vanity.
gltv@Ecclesiastes:2:16 @ For there is not a memory of the wise more than with the fool forever, in that already the days to come will be forgotten. And how does the wise die above the fool?
